The paper is mainly about3D seismic acquisition technology of block WUDONG ofWuerxun depression. Owing to the influence of depression faults, the depth of same formationis changeable a lot, S/N OF seismic data is more different, the faults are complicated and dipangle is big, so there are following obstacles, such as the requisition of high inline andcrossline resolution, acquisition geometry factors and shooting parameters optimizationdifficultly, the environmental noise (mainly wind) influence upon high frequency data. Inorder to acquire total geologic information underground exactly and meet the reservoirrequirement of high resolution survey, this paper analyzes some frequency band of the seismicdata of HAILAR basin shows weak in terms of both surface and deep seismic geologicconditions. First, from the old data, analyzes and summarizes the previous section, shot record,well data, provided a favorable basis for the acquisition system parameters demonstration. Itis demonstrated in detail from acquisition parameters optimization, shooting and receiverparameters, instrument preamplification and operation, and then the effective acquisitionmethods to improve data quality are presented. That is the appropriate charge shooting ongroup, some strings areal array receiving, oblique acquisition system, reasonable factors ofpreamplification and standardization of construction processes. The data S/N and resolutionare improved greatly by above technologies. The T2-2event is continuous well in bandwith60-120Hz seismic section processed on site, T3and T5events are fairly continued inbandwith45-90Hz seismic profile. The author summarized and presented a series of seismicacquisition techniques in grass area of Wudong depression of Hailaer basin, and obtained a setof geology section which folds are uniform, the details of interlayer are clear, energy of deepformation is strong, structures and features are more distinct. Then the article establishedsome procedures about standardized operation in grassland of HAILAER basin. All in all, theseismic acquisition technologies and standardized operation procedures can take guidedeffects in follow-up similar seismic acquisition blocks.
